My chief issue with "Profit and Lace" is how it treats women's suffrage: "Bang the right guy and women go from chattel to full equals". It doesn't come that easily. It would have been a worthy three-peater, but I guess two golds and a silver is still pretty impressive in an appalling sort of way.

Say what you want about "Angel One" and "Cogenitor", at least they understand that gender equality takes time and often comes at a cost.

"Profit & Lace" is definitely the more offensive episode. It has so many offensive aspects I couldn't even tell you which is the worst. The transphobia? The sexism & misogyny? The rape comedy? The endorsement of sexual coercion in the workplace? It's all just outrageous.

That being said, on a technical level it is definitely better crafted than "Terra Nova." "P&L" is better produced, better acted, and has a better structure (which perhaps makes it even more offensive?).
